- Sidmennt abstract "Siðmennt, the Icelandic Ethical Humanist Association ((Icelandic) Siðmennt, félag siðrænna húmanista á Íslandi) is closely tied with the Norwegian Human-Etisk Forbund (HEF) and is a member of the International Humanist and Ethical Union (IHEU). After the first civil confirmation in Iceland in 1989, the society was founded in February 1990. Since then it directs civil confirmations every year. Until 2008 it gave information about organizing secular funerals and name-giving ceremonies. Sidmennt holds annually lectures and meetings about life stance issues. From May 29, 2008 Siðmennt has offered the services of trained celebrants to conduct secular or humanistic ceremonies, including name-givings, weddings and funerals. Siðmennt is active in the movement for separation of church and state in Iceland.Chairman and a founder of the society is Hope Knutsson.Its name, Sidmennt is derived from the Icelandic words "sið" meaning "ethical" and "mennt" for "education". This is appropriate since as a life stance organization its primary subject is ethics and education on how to lead an ethical life or develop mature ethical practices and theory further.Sidmennt has three main areas of concernEthics - mostly practical ethics and human rights issues. Promotion of humanistic values. Epistemology - Its approach is naturalistic and rejects supernaturalism. Family ceremonies – Secular baby-naming, confirmation, weddings (and vows) and funeral ceremonies conducted by trained celebrants. As with IHEU the association has the "happy human" as its logo but has adopted its own version of it that was designed in 2008 by one of its board member, Svanur Sigurbjörnsson.From 2005 Sidmennt has awarded annually an individual or organization the "Sidmennt award of Humanism" for outstanding work on improving human rights in Iceland. From 2008 Sidmennt has awarded at the same ceremony the "Sidmennt award for Education and Science". In Iceland it applied until early 2013 that secular life stance organizations that are not categorized as religious (like Sidmennt) were not entitled to receive "parish member fees" (sóknargjöld) through the state the way registered religious groups do. Also the secular one's could not take care of the legal aspect of marriage ceremonies. Instead, these church taxes were collected from people who are not members of any registered religious group and given to the University of Iceland. After 2009 it was not given to any particular party. This was changed in 2013 after over 7 years of Sidmennt fighting for a legal change to give secular life stance organizations equal legal status and funding to the religious organizations it finally was accepted and a new law was passed on January 30th 2013.".
